Job Summary
The Integration Engineer will be the Single Point of Contact for all technical deployments, troubleshooting and configuration for Mobile Financial Services delivery in opco. The role requires strong technical acumen and a deep end to end understanding of MFS infrastructure and related setup. Talent will also be responsible among other duties to share feedback to Business Analyst counterpart and Customer Adaptation Centre for the purposes of process and code improvement.
Job Description Responsibilities & Tasks
- Install, Integrate, commission the network nodes under ECW/ EWP solution
- Support Business Analyst and Solution Architect for new requirements and design changes
- Understand technical requirements as specified in the Solution document
- Perform ECW Integration and configuration changes activities within approved change window.
- Prepare test cases in consultation with Solution Architect/BA & Conduct Integration tests with 3 PP’s
- Report progress of assigned activities to the respective Business Analyst and CPM.
- CAB participation & Change Coordination between MTN/3PP & GNOC
- Coordinate UAT/SIT result sign off
- End to end issue handling and coordination with GSC
- Internal & external Audit handling
- Support in troubleshooting and resolution of technical issues on EWP
- Engage closely with customer and other stakeholders during the testing phase of solutions
- Overall responsible for usecase testing and relay defect feedback to Customer Adaptation Centre
